Executive Summary
What the company appears to be
Yo te Llevo (translated as "I'll give you a ride") is a self-reported peer-to-peer ride-hailing platform built by one individual developer, Joel Cortes, for the OpenAI 2026 hackathon. The project is described as a platform connecting passengers with drivers, using PHP and SQL technologies.
What changed
The project was submitted to a hackathon, indicating it is in an early development or prototype stage. No commercial traction, revenue, or customer data is evident.
Single most important open question
Is this a functional product or a proof-of-concept? The description does not indicate whether the platform has been tested with real users or deployed for actual ride-hailing services.
